Overall Meaning

The lyrics to Holland Jools's song "Nobody But You" express a sense of isolation and longing for a supportive presence in the singer's life. The opening lines describe a lack of encouragement or assistance from others, with the singer feeling like they have had to rely solely on themselves to succeed and that all they have received from others is taking. This sets the tone for the rest of the song, which emphasizes the feeling of being alone and unnoticed as the singer navigates through life's challenges.


The chorus serves as a refrain, repeating the line "Nobody but you" over and over again. This line functions as both a statement and a plea – the singer acknowledges that there has been nobody in their life to provide the type of support they need, but also hopes that someone like "you" (an unspecified person, likely a romantic partner or close friend) might come along and fill that void. The lack of specific details about who this "you" might be allows the lyrics to remain open to interpretation and relatable to listeners who are experiencing similar feelings of loneliness.


Overall, "Nobody But You" is a poignant expression of the desire for companionship and emotional connection. It speaks to the universal human need for support and recognition, and reminds us of the importance of having people in our lives who are willing to offer that support and help us navigate life's challenges.
